What do you think of the drawings made by
April when she was a small child? It can be
supposed that these are the same drawings
that can be seen in the main menu. In the
drawing ``begin a new journey'', there can
be seen someone with a bag, looking like
going to a journey. Therefore I suppose the
person may symbolize April. Note that the
person has a red dress. So perhaps this is
the same person as that one in the red dress
seen in the drawings ``continue the journey''
and ``finish the journey''. The room in the
''finish the journey'' drawing resembles me of
the room where was Lady Alvane. In the
drawing, there can be seen someone who
looks like a child playing with a pet animal
or perhaps with a toy. As I described it above,
because of the red dress it may be supposed
that the person in the drawing is April. It
could be therefore hypothesized that April
had been once in the room, when she was
a very young child, and that she drew her
remembrances. It could explain also why, if
I remember well, April told, when whe
meet Lady Alvane, that the room she sees
looks somewhat familiar to her. It can
also remind that April was once adopted.
